IN PAKISTAN We have been enabled to supply during this year Pastor Patras with 310 Bibles in URDU for distribution. We were not able to supply all we had hoped to, due to a 50% price increase due to the fall in the value of the £ due to Brexit. He pastors the area where 100 people died at Christmas from poisoned alcohol
He has asked for 500 more Bibles for Easter that would cost £3500..He accepts that this wont happen now but over the year hopes to deliver 600 in villages near where he lives..
IN ZAMBIA We have recently sent 6 Study Bibles for the 45 strong Never Give Up Hope Group of Christian lifer prisoners begun by Frank Chilufla who is in it , now led by Lloyd Kushipa in the Maximum Security Prison at Kabwe , 3 in English and 3 in Aramaic to be shared by a group of 15 Ethiopian prisoners. We also sent 2 Study Bibles with Concordance, commentary and maps. Namashoba Kagoba the new Leader of the 20 strong Christian Care Group on Death Row for which He runs Alpha Courses, and teaches RI and IT in the Prison Training Centre, We have also sent both groups packets of Christian magazines and Commentary material. We have also heard again briefly by an email from Elder Chanda Jackson asking for help for medical fees. He is still very ill. He it was who pioneered 4 churches in the Nchelenge area that we have helped over a decade with Bibles & Christian literature.
LOCALLY THE CIRCULATION OF VIA MAGAZINE IN SAFFRON WALDEN labelled with options for finding out more, have now been completed to over 4500 homes leaving about 2000 – 2500 to go. To new homes as they come on line we include a leaflet CHRISTIANS TOGETHER IN SAFFRON WALDEN that includes the locations, Sunday morning service times, and website addresses for all the Christian congregations in Saffron Walden. As one newcomer to the town mentioned recently “ the Churches in Saffron Walden do not advertise themselves much for new residents.” Maybe that is one reason why total Church attendances at worship average 1,300 – 1,500 when the 2011 Census figures indicated 9750+ people in the town regarded themselves as Christians. One wonders where the rest worship, the roads to Cambridge, Stortford , Haverhill , Harlow and the villages must be choked on Sundays, but judging by the congregations there, not many get through, and then there are the 6,500 or more who claim not to be Christians .
